In 1994, Carter’s friend Wez, from former support band Resque, joined the band on drums and the newly inspired trio played America, Japan and Europe, including a major concert in Croatia which was recorded and later released on video. The recording was also given away as a free live album with Carter’s fifth studio LP, Worry Bomb – a punk-pop album with upbeat material such as “Let’s Get Tattoos” and slow acoustic songs such as “My Defeatist Attitude”.
